The GE FANUC HE693THM809C Thermocouple Input Module is an advanced component designed for precise temperature measurement in industrial control systems. It provides reliable and accurate data, essential for critical monitoring and control applications.

Thermocouple Compatibility:Supports various thermocouple types including J, K, E, T, R, S, B, and N

Temperature Range:-200°C to +1600°C

Signal Output:0-10VDC or 4-20mA, configurable via software settings

Input Resistance:100Ω ±1% at 25°C

Power Consumption:Less than 0.5W

Operating Temperature:-40°C to +70°C

Humidity Range:5% to 95% non-condensing

Enclosure Rating:IP65, dustproof and splash-proof
